Output 59db374683effff73bf2336239c56bc75d2fbfc016776b7632af7f46e1705ab8:15

value
99492
script pubkey
OP_0 OP_PUSHBYTES_20 082eba4552b6926a07af8b3180bc485fcfe25e48
address
bc1qpqht532jk6fx5pa03vccp0zgtl87yhjg0ts0x0
transaction
59db374683effff73bf2336239c56bc75d2fbfc016776b7632af7f46e1705ab8
confirmations
10219
spent
true